Fighting off the Demon Spawn
In Peace Corps, I learned a valuable lesson during my run to Russia. Okay, well technically it was after we got stopped at the border we were trying to cross illegally wanted to visit and after the border guards told us to get into a van that had just crossed the border and dropped us […]